John left the museum and drove south at a rate of 55 mph. Sally left four hours later driving 10 mph faster than John in an effort to catch up to him. How
long did Sally have to drive to catch up with John?
28 hours
22 hours
20 hours
18 hours
Answer:
22 hours (B)
Step-by-step explanation:
John's velocity = 55mph
Sally's velocity = 65mph
John's time taken = x
Sally's time taken = x - 4
since they must cover the same distance.
and, distance = vel × time
Sally's vel × time = John's vel × time
55x = 65(x-4)
55x = 65x - 220
-10x = -220
x = 22 hours.
Therefore, Sally catches up after 22 hours
1. The possible missing terms to make x²_____+100 a perfect square trinomial are
a. 4x and 25x.
b. -10x and 10x.
c. -20x and 20x.
d. -4x and -25x.
Answer:
c. -20x and 20x
Step-by-step explanation:
x² is the square of x.
100 is the square of 10 and of -10.
The middle term of (a + b)² is 2ab.
For b = 10:
2ab = 20x
for b = -10:
2ab = -20x
Answer: c. -20x and 20x

Linda is making curtains . She has 2 1/3 yards of material . She wants to make 3 curtains . She needs 8/9 yard for each curtain . Does she have enough material for 3 curtains?
======================================================
Use this formula
a & b/c = (a*c + b)/c
to convert from a mixed number to an improper fraction.
Let's use that formula to find the following
a & b/c = (a*c + b)/c
2 & 1/3 = (2*3+1)/3
2 & 1/3 = 7/3
She has 7/3 yards of material.
Linda wants to make 3 curtains. Each curtain needs 8/9 of a yard.
3*(8/9) = 24/9 = (8*3)/(3*3) = 8/3
Therefore, she needs 8/3 yards of material.
But this is a problem because she needs more material than what she has on hand. In other words, 8/3 > 7/3 since 8 > 7.
-----------
Another way to look at it:
7/3 = 2.333 yards is the approximate amount of fabric she has
8/3 = 2.667 approximately is the total amount of fabric she needs, which is clearly larger than the 2.333 yards she has.
Unfortunately Linda does not have enough fabric to make 3 curtains.

A set of final examination grades in an introductory statistics course is normally distributed, with a mean of 73 and a standard deviation of 8.
a. What is the probability that a student scored below 91 on this exam?
b. What is the probability that a student scored between 65 and 89?
c. If the professor grades on a curve (i.e., gives A’s to the top 10% of the class, regardless of the score), are you better off with a grade of 81 on this exam or a grade of 68 on a different exam, where the mean is 62 and the standard deviation is 3? Show your answer statistically and explain. (Hint: For option 1, you need to find a minimum Z-score that will guarantee you that you will be in the top 10% of the class.)
a. The probability that a student scored below 91 on this exam is 0.9878
b. The probability that a student scored between 65 and 89 is 0.8186.
c. A grade of 68 on the second exam is better than a grade of 81 on the first exam for the given conditions
a. To find the probability that a student scored below 91 on the exam, we need to find the area under the normal distribution curve to the left of 91. Using a standard normal distribution table or calculator, we can find the corresponding Z-score as:
Z = (91 - 73) / 8 = 2.25
The probability of scoring below 91 is then the same as the probability of a standard normal random variable being less than 2.25, which is approximately 0.9878.
b. To find the probability that a student scored between 65 and 89, we need to find the area under the normal distribution curve between these two values. Using the Z-score formula as above, we find:
Z1 = (65 - 73) / 8 = -1.00
Z2 = (89 - 73) / 8 = 2.00
Using a standard normal distribution table or calculator, we can find the probability of a standard normal random variable being between -1.00 and 2.00, which is approximately 0.8186.
c. To determine if a grade of 81 on this exam or a grade of 68 on a different exam is better if the professor grades on a curve, we need to find the Z-score that corresponds to the top 10% of the class. Using a standard normal distribution table or calculator, we can find this Z-score as:
Z = 1.28 (approximately)
For the first exam, the Z-score corresponding to a grade of 81 is:
Z = (81 - 73) / 8 = 1.00
Since 1.00 < 1.28, a grade of 81 is not in the top 10% of the class. For the second exam, the Z-score corresponding to a grade of 68 is:
Z = (68 - 62) / 3 = 2.00
Since 2.00 > 1.28, a grade of 68 is in the top 10% of the class. Therefore, if the professor grades on a curve, a grade of 68 on the second exam is better than a grade of 81 on the first exam.

What inequality represents all the values of x for y <
-5(x - 8) - 2 when y = 7?
Answer:
(−∞, 31/5) or x <31/5 (the graph will start a little bit past 6 and will be a open circle and head to the left)
Answer:
x< 6\(\frac{1}{5}\)
Step-by-step explanation:
7<-5(x -8) - 2 Distribute the 5
7<-5x + 40 - 2
7<-5x +38 Subtract 38 from both sides
-31<-5x Divide both sides by -5
\(\frac{31}{5}\) >x When you divide both sides by a negative number, you must flip the sign.
or
x < 6 \(\frac{1}{5}\)
